Design and Portability: Built for Travel or Comfort?
The physical experience of using a handheld device is critical. How it feels in your hands, how easy it is to carry, and how durable it is during travel can make or break its appeal as a portable system.
The Nintendo Switch OLED weighs approximately 420 grams (about 14.8 ounces) and features a sleek, minimalist design with a vibrant 7-inch OLED screen. Its form factor has been refined over years of user feedback—slimmer bezels, improved kickstand, and a USB-C port positioned at the bottom. The lightweight build makes it ideal for slipping into a backpack or holding for extended play sessions during commutes or flights.
In contrast, the Steam Deck is significantly bulkier. It weighs around 669 grams (nearly 23.6 ounces), almost 60% heavier than the Switch OLED. With a larger 7.4-inch LCD screen and a more complex control layout—including dual trackpads, rear triggers, and additional shoulder buttons—the Steam Deck prioritizes functionality over minimalism. While it’s still portable, it demands more space and is less comfortable for one-handed use or casual couch gaming.
Portability also extends to accessories. The Switch OLED works seamlessly with compact carrying cases, third-party battery packs, and even mobile docks. The Steam Deck requires sturdier protection due to its size and exposed trackpads, often needing custom cases that add further bulk.
Performance: Native Console Power vs Full PC Flexibility
Performance differences between the two devices are stark—not because one is objectively \"better,\" but because they serve entirely different purposes.
The Switch OLED runs on custom NVIDIA Tegra hardware optimized for Nintendo’s first-party titles and select third-party ports. Games like The Legend of Zelda: Tears of the Kingdom, Super Mario Odyssey, and Metroid Dread run smoothly at native resolutions up to 720p in handheld mode. The OLED screen enhances visual fidelity with deeper blacks and richer colors, making games more immersive despite modest technical specs.
However, the Switch’s hardware limitations become apparent with demanding indie or multiplatform titles. Games like Hollow Knight: Silksong or Bloodstained: Ritual of the Night may suffer from frame drops or reduced textures. Emulation beyond GameCube-era consoles is limited without modding, which voids warranties and introduces complexity.
The Steam Deck, powered by an AMD APU with Zen 2 CPU cores and RDNA 2 graphics architecture, is essentially a mini gaming PC. It can run modern AAA titles like Elden Ring, Disco Elysium – The Final Cut, and Portal 2 at playable frame rates—often between 30–60 FPS depending on settings. With access to the full Steam library (over 50,000 titles), Proton compatibility layers, and community-created performance presets, users have unprecedented control over graphical quality and optimization.
“While the Switch excels in curated experiences, the Steam Deck unlocks a decade of PC gaming evolution in a handheld form.” — Marcus Lin, Senior Hardware Analyst at TechPlay Insights
That said, raw performance comes at a cost. High-intensity games drain the battery quickly, sometimes lasting under two hours. Thermal throttling can occur during prolonged sessions, especially without proper ventilation. The fan noise, while not excessive, is audible—something the silent, fanless Switch avoids entirely.
Display, Controls, and User Experience
A great gaming experience hinges on more than just processing power. Screen quality, input responsiveness, and interface design shape how enjoyable each device feels day-to-day.
| Feature | Nintendo Switch OLED | Steam Deck |
|---|---|---|
| Screen Size & Type | 7\" OLED | 7.4\" LCD (IPS) |
| Resolution | 1280×720 | 1280×800 |
| Refresh Rate | 60Hz | 60Hz |
| Controls | Digital D-pad, analog sticks, HD Rumble | Mechanical buttons, dual trackpads, gyro, rear paddles |
| Operating System | Proprietary (Nintendo OS) | SteamOS (Linux-based) |
| Storage (Base Model) | 64GB (expandable via microSD) | 64GB eMMC / 256GB NVMe SSD |
The Switch OLED’s OLED panel delivers superior contrast and color vibrancy, particularly noticeable in dark scenes or stylized art games. However, its smaller resolution and lack of touch controls limit interactivity compared to the Steam Deck’s slightly taller aspect ratio and responsive touchscreen.
Control-wise, the Steam Deck offers far greater versatility. The inclusion of trackpads allows precise cursor control for RPGs, strategy games, and desktop navigation. Rear grip buttons let players remap functions for FPS or MOBA titles. Meanwhile, the Switch relies heavily on Joy-Con flexibility—detachable controllers useful for multiplayer but prone to drift issues over time.
User experience diverges sharply. The Switch’s interface is intuitive, family-friendly, and focused solely on launching games. The Steam Deck runs SteamOS, which mimics the desktop Steam client but includes a controller-optimized UI. While powerful, it has a learning curve—especially when managing game installations, Proton compatibility, or file permissions.
Battery Life and Real-World Usability
No matter how impressive the hardware, battery life determines whether a handheld truly supports on-the-go play.
The Switch OLED averages between 4.5 to 9 hours per charge, depending on the game. Lighter titles like Animal Crossing: New Horizons can stretch close to nine hours, while graphically intense games such as The Witcher 3 reduce runtime to around five. Its efficient chipset and absence of active cooling contribute to consistent longevity.
The Steam Deck ranges from 2 to 8 hours, with most AAA games consuming power rapidly. Lowering resolution via FSR, reducing frame rate caps, and undervolting the CPU can extend playtime significantly. Users who optimize settings report up to six hours with indie titles like Hades or retro emulations. Still, unplugging from the charger often means planning ahead.
Charging behavior differs too. The Switch OLED charges via standard USB-C and supports pass-through charging with most docks. The Steam Deck requires a higher-wattage adapter (at least 45W recommended) for optimal charging speed, especially when gaming while plugged in.
Mini Case Study: Cross-Country Flight Gaming Test
Consider Sarah, a frequent traveler and avid gamer, preparing for a six-hour flight from New York to Los Angeles. She owns both the Switch OLED and Steam Deck and decides to test them side-by-side.
She starts with the Steam Deck, playing Stardew Valley on low settings. After four hours, the battery reads 20%. She switches to Dead Cells briefly, and within 45 minutes, the device shuts down. She recharges using a 65W PD power bank and resumes play after 30 minutes.
With the Switch OLED, she plays Fire Emblem: Three Houses for nearly five hours straight, ending the flight with 15% battery remaining. No interruptions, no overheating, and no need for external charging.
For travelers prioritizing reliability and uninterrupted gameplay, the Switch OLED clearly holds the edge.
Game Library and Long-Term Value
Ultimately, the best handheld is the one that plays the games you love.
The Switch OLED boasts exclusive franchises: Mario, Zelda, Pokémon, Splatoon, and Animal Crossing. These titles are critically acclaimed, family-accessible, and often define generations of gaming. Third-party support remains strong, though some ports (like Cyberpunk 2077) never materialized due to hardware constraints.
The Steam Deck gives access to virtually every game available on PC—provided it runs well. Through Steam’s Verified, Playable, and Unsupported tiers, Valve helps users identify compatible titles. Popular hits like Half-Life 2, Divinity: Original Sin 2, and Disco Elysium are fully supported. Even older operating systems like Windows 98 can be emulated for niche retro projects.
- Switch Strengths: Polished exclusives, local multiplayer, parental controls, child-friendly interface.
- Steam Deck Strengths: Vast library, mod support, cloud saves, backward compatibility, homebrew potential.
Long-term value depends on usage patterns. Families or casual players will find sustained joy in the Switch’s steady release calendar. Hardcore gamers seeking depth, customization, and legacy titles benefit more from the Steam Deck’s openness—even if it demands more maintenance.

Frequently Asked Questions
Can the Steam Deck run all Steam games?
No, not all Steam games are compatible. While thousands are verified or playable through Proton, some anti-cheat systems (like Easy Anti-Cheat in certain online shooters) prevent launch. Always check the Steam Deck compatibility tag before purchasing a title.
Is the Switch OLED worth upgrading to from the original model?
If you value screen quality, audio improvements, and a better kickstand, yes. The OLED model enhances the handheld experience significantly, though performance remains identical to the original Switch.
Which device is better for retro gaming?
The Steam Deck is superior for retro gaming due to built-in emulator support, save states, and shader enhancements. While the Switch offers classic games through Nintendo Switch Online, its library is limited and lacks customization options.
Conclusion: Which Handheld Wins?
There is no single winner between the Nintendo Switch OLED and the Steam Deck—only the right tool for your gaming lifestyle.
The Switch OLED triumphs in portability, battery efficiency, and seamless user experience. It’s designed for pick-up-and-play moments, shared fun, and reliable performance across a curated catalog of standout titles. For families, travelers, and fans of Nintendo’s universe, it remains unmatched.
The Steam Deck wins on performance, flexibility, and long-term potential. It transforms your hands into a portal to decades of PC gaming history, offering unparalleled freedom—for those willing to navigate its complexity and power demands.
Your decision should hinge not on specs alone, but on how, where, and why you play. Want effortless fun wherever you go? The Switch OLED delivers. Crave deep immersion, modding, and expansive libraries? The Steam Deck answers that call.
